The hysteresis is affected by viscosity, friction, flow forces, dither frequency and modulation frequency.
Technical data
Supply Voltage U
DC
12 V
DC
24 V
DC
Current input
0 – 1500 mA
0 – 750 mA
Resistance
4.75 Ω ± 5 %
20.8 Ω ± 5 %
Response time
150 to 200 ms
PWM frequency
100 to 400 Hz
Main spool spring control pressure
range
5 – 15 bar [73 – 218 psi]
Pilot oil pressure range
20 – 25 bar [290 – 362 psi]
Ambient temperature range
-30°C to 80°C [-22 °F to 176°F]
Temperature range
-20°C to 80°C [-4 °F to 176°F]
Fluid cleanliness
23/19/16 (according to ISO 4406)
